Why Is NSN 5915-00-827-7206 Paired with Part Number FS8277-206?
  • Part Number FS8277-206 is the identification assigned to the item by Frequency Selective Networks Inc Managed, serving as an easy form of identification for the company’s supplied items. On the other hand, NSN 5915-00-827-7206 is a NATO-recognized code assigned to this item based on its design and use, serving as an identifier that may also be used for other manufacturers producing the same form of product. As such, utilizing both part number and NSN data ensures that you can locate and procure exact requirements.
